This 1-hour EMDR webinar provides an overview of *targeting Obsessive-Compulsive Disorder (OCD)* within the EMDR framework, emphasizing the underlying trauma-related drivers of obsession, compulsion, and control. Participants will learn how intrusive thoughts and repetitive behaviors often reflect attempts to manage anxiety or prevent perceived catastrophe—functions that can be understood and addressed through trauma-informed targeting and processing.

The webinar highlights *assessment strategies, target sequencing, and interweaves* that address both the core fear network and the secondary shame or helplessness that sustain OCD cycles. Case examples will demonstrate how to differentiate between ego-dystonic obsessions and trauma-linked intrusive cognitions, and how to safely use EMDR to disrupt maladaptive patterns without reinforcing compulsive reassurance or avoidance.
